Estimate an order from geometry and product yield

  1. Add each slab, cylinder or round post hole. Choose units for each dimension and enter only the post depth actually inside the concrete.
  2. Set waste and finished volume per bag using your product label or an identified QUIKRETE example. Choose currency and enter optional unit price and delivery.
  3. Calculate total volume before rounding up bags. Review every area and supplier assumptions, then export the material estimate.

A slab with a waste allowance

10 ft × 10 ft × 4 in is 33.3333 ft³. With 10% waste and 0.6 ft³ per bag, buy 62 bags. At USD 6 each plus USD 20 delivery, the estimate is USD 392.

No structural design, thickness recommendation, live prices or automatic taxes. Product yields are approximate; verify current packaging, measurements and supplier minimum orders.
